Weather in July

July, the same as June, is a moderately hot summer month in Pilot Mound, Iowa, with temperature in the range of an average high of 81.5°F (27.5°C) and an average low of 64.4°F (18°C).

Heat index

The heat index in July is computed to be a tropical 87.8°F (31°C). Persistent activity under exposure might lead to a feeling of weariness, with subsequent heat cramps.
Bear in mind that the heat index values are determined for shaded areas and light breezes. A direct sunlight exposure may boost the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', is a metric representing the sensation of warmth when air temperature and moisture come together. The individual's temperature perception can be influenced by numerous factors such as metabolic variations, physical activity, and clothing. It is noteworthy that being in direct sunlight can enhance the weather's impact, raising the heat index by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Young children are generally more endangered than adults, as they usually less sweat. And also, due to lar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and higher heat production as a result of their activity.

Humidity

In Pilot Mound, the average relative humidity in July is 82%.

Rainfall

In Pilot Mound, in July, it is raining for 14.5 days, with typically 2.24" (57m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 126.1 rainfall days, and 26.85" (682m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

June through September are months without snowfall in Pilot Mound.

Daylight

In Pilot Mound, Iowa, the average length of the day in July is 14h and 54min.
On the first day of July, sunrise is at 5:44 am and sunset at 8:56 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:08 am and sunset at 8:35 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The month with the most sunshine is July, with an average of 10h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Pilot Mound, Iowa, are June and July,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
